Complete Guide to the Movie Night Quest in ARC Raiders
The Movie Night quest arrives with the ARC Raiders:Headwinds update as a rare pause in the ongoing fight against the ARC machines. Instead of another high-risk combat assignment, Apollo suggests something more human—organizing a movie night at Speranza to keep morale alive. What sounds simple quickly becomes dangerous, as the necessary equipment must be recovered from abandoned ruins crawling with enemies.
To finish this quest, players must recover Old Movie Tapes and a Portable TV, extract safely with both items, and deliver them to Apollo. This guide explains where to search, how to avoid unnecessary risks, and how to complete the mission efficiently.
Old Movie Tape Location in ARC Raiders
The Old Movie Tapes are located in the Cultural Archives on the Stella Montis map. This zone sits east of the Business Center and is well known for drawing players due to its high-tier loot and frequent enemy encounters.

What to Expect Inside the Cultural Archives
The Cultural Archives is a tight urban environment cluttered with collapsed structures, storage containers, and debris. Hostile threats commonly found here include:
Ticks, which attack in groups and can overwhelm players quickly
Shredders, extremely dangerous if engaged without cover or preparation
Before entering, repair your equipment, bring healing supplies, and ensure you have enough inventory space to secure the quest items.
How to Find the Old Movie Tapes
Once inside the Cultural Archives, open your map and locate a blue cross icon inside a circular marker. This symbol indicates the specific search area for the Movie Night quest.
Within this zone, look for tarp-covered boxes. These containers are visually distinct and are the only objects that can spawn the Old Movie Tapes.
Immediately place the tapes into your Safe Pocket. Doing so guarantees they remain protected even if you are forced to retreat or fail extraction.
Finding a Portable TV for Movie Night
After securing the tapes, your next objective is to locate a Portable TV. Unlike the tapes, the TV has no fixed spawn point, making this portion of the quest more dependent on luck.
Portable TV Spawns in the Cultural Archives
Your first attempt should still focus on the Cultural Archives. Portable TVs can appear in several types of loot locations, including:
Cabinets and drawers
Breakable transport containers
On top of furniture such as desks, chairs, and storage shelves
Be thorough when searching—many TVs are missed because players fail to check elevated surfaces.
Alternative Locations for Portable TVs
If you don't find a Portable TV during your initial run, extract safely and try again elsewhere. The Portable TV is classified as a residential loot item, meaning it appears most often in living areas.
The best alternative map for farming TVs is Buried City.
Best Areas in Buried City for Portable TVs
Focus your search on zones with multiple residential interiors:
Grandioso Apartments
Santa Maria Homes
Red Tower
Space Travel buildings
These areas contain numerous apartments and rooms, significantly increasing the chance of finding a TV. Buried City also has more predictable enemy routes, making it a safer option for solo players.
Safe Extraction Tips
Both quest items must be extracted successfully, so survival is critical. To reduce risk:
Leave the area immediately after securing quest items
Use smoke grenades to break enemy line of sight
Plan extraction routes before looting
Favor stealth and avoidance over direct combat

Movie Night Quest Rewards
Once both the Old Movie Tapes and Portable TV are returned to Apollo in Speranza, the quest is complete. You'll receive:
3× Showstopper Grenades
3× Smoke Grenades
1× Fireworks Box
These rewards provide a mix of offensive power and tactical utility for future raids.
